**CI note: timezone weirdness in report exports**

Heads up, support folks — if a customer says their Ledgerpine export shows times shifted by a few hours, it's probably the CI image. The export workers got rebuilt last week and the base image defaults to UTC, while older workers used the account's locale. Fix is rolling out; meanwhile tell customers the data itself is fine, just the display offset. Affected exports carry the build token shown below.

build token for bajof-tahop: htk4_a981

Capacity note for the Bramblewick export retry queue. Failed exports are requeued with exponential backoff, and the queue depth is our main capacity signal: sustained depth above the high-water mark means downstream Pellis storage is saturated, not that we need more workers. As the new contractor, please don't raise worker counts without checking storage latency first — it usually makes things worse. Retry timing, backoff caps, and the high-water threshold are all driven by the constants shown below.

limits module of yagef-bajog:
TIERS = {
    "druael": 370,
    "tamix": 286,
    "pelius": 541,
    "pelael": 78,
    "pelox": 47,
    "ralath": 533,
    "drumir": 801,
}

# DeployDot Changelog — Changed Defaults

DeployDot, our deploy-status chat bot, now polls the pipeline API every 30 seconds instead of 10, and silent mode is on by default outside business hours. If you joined recently, note that older runbooks still reference the previous defaults. The current default configuration is shown below.

config for badup-kagap:
OLIOX_PIN=5344
OLIOX_METRICS_HOST=metrics.oliox.zemvarcorp.corp
OLIOX_LOG_LEVEL=error
OLIOX_TENANT=pelox

09:47 — The Harrowfield telemetry gateway started accepting unsigned payloads from tractors in the western region after a config push dropped the signature-check flag. Nobody noticed for about forty minutes because the dashboards only track volume, not validity. We re-enabled verification and quarantined the suspect window of data. Heads up for the review: the bad config shipped in the build tagged below.

pipeline stamp: htk6_c0ef30